With reference to figure 1 and Fig. 2, Fig. 1 and Fig. 2, sectional view and three-dimensional view have shown that a kind of miniature movable type water spray helps respectively
Power drainage robot, including bottom plate 4, walking mechanism and water pump 1, the draining pump 1 are arranged on bottom plate 4, the walking mechanism
On bottom plate 4, the delivery port of the water pump 1 is opposite with the direction of advance of robot.Bottom plate 4 is as main rack construction
For obstructed plate of revealing the exact details, prevent bottom debris enters water pump 1, and power-assisted jet pipe is provided with the delivery port of the water pump 1, described to help
Power jet pipe includes main pipeline 11 and the branch pipe(tube) 9 of the both sides of main pipeline 11, and the internal diameter of the branch pipe(tube) 9 is the 1/ of the internal diameter of main pipeline 11
3~1/2.
Connected between the delivery port of the main pipeline 11 and water pump 1 by adpting flange, pass through electromagnetism on the branch pipe(tube) 9
The control of valve 10 is switched on and off, and the axis of two branch pipe(tube)s 9 is with the diameter parallel of main pipeline 11 and in same level.
The walking mechanism is cterpillar drive, and the cterpillar drive is included installed in the both sides of bottom plate 4
Four driving wheels 6, the crawler belt 5 of a closed loop is assembled on the driving wheel 6 of homonymy, driving wheel 6 is driven by motor 7, preceding
Multiple bogie wheels 12 are additionally provided between rear drive sprocket 6, bogie wheel 12 adds the contact area between crawler belt 5 and road surface, kept away
The weight for having exempted from vehicle is all pressed on driving wheel 6 and is easily recessed, and it also avoid the crawler belt in the space between front and rear driving wheel 6
5 are easily blocked by projection.The crawler belt 5 is rubber belt track, and the frictional force between rubber belt track and contact surface is big, prevents robot
Skid in the process of walking.
The power input structure of the water pump 1 is waterproof three phase electric machine 3, the output shaft and water of the waterproof three phase electric machine 3
The impeller of pump 1 is connected by shaft coupling 2.
Robot also includes sealing electric cabinet, and the sealing electric cabinet is arranged on bottom plate 4, and seal has in electric cabinet
Wireless communication module, Chargeable direct current power supply and with travelling control driver, remote control pass through wireless communication module with walking control
Driver processed is communicatively coupled.
The all cover grid screen 8 for impurity screening is provided with above bottom plate 4, the water pump 1 is located at all cover grid
In net 8, the position reserved through hole of the corresponding delivery port of water pump 1 of all cover grid screen 8, the delivery port outer rim of water pump 1 with through hole
Gap between circle is not more than the grid aperture of all cover grid screen 8, and all cover grid 8 prevents big impurity from entering water pump
In 1, it can make robot that there is longer cleaning cycle.
The road conditions in the underwater track route of robot and front of advancing are understood for the ease of operating personnel, in addition to it is underwater
Video camera, the Underwater Camera are arranged on the top of sealing electric cabinet, the collection side by Underwater Camera to front road conditions
Convenient to operate personnel send the direction of travel that order changes robot to robot in time.
Robot normally walk work when two branch pipe(tube)s 9 two magnetic valves 10 be closed mode, flow through the current of body by
Import A all flows to outlet B.When underwater drainage robot ambulation occurs difficult, two magnetic valves 10 are opened, part or all
Water flows into two branch pipe(tube)s 9, and the motive force for spraying the kinetic energy offer of water plays a part of helping to promote robot to advance.Work as steering
The magnetic valve 10 that one side can also be only opened when occurring difficult carries out unilateral water spray, and help turns to or rectified a deviation.
